2. Productivity Apps
Gone are the days of Post-it notes and traditional calendars. Productivity apps like Notion and Asana are becoming increasingly popular among those working from home, allowing users to map out deadlines, plan weekly events and create the ideal work-life balance. Using templates and creative online tools, these apps are moulding the future of planning.
This is particularly great in the case you have older children, a great feature of these online tools is the ability to share your plans with your school-aged children, allowing them to have a clearer visual understanding of your workload and availability. This shared scheduling feature is particularly valuable for single parents with high school-aged kids, who you’re more likely to have to orchestrate independent pick-up and drop-off schedules with.

6. A Webcam (with a Privacy Shutter)
As parents, we always want to protect our children, and as workers, we always want to appear professional and in control. One of our recommended picks for remaining professional whilst working from home is investing in a high-quality webcam with a privacy shutter, giving peace of mind to those with little ones.
Webcams with an added privacy shutter can physically block the camera lens, preventing hackers or other team members from viewing you when used, allowing us to remain safe and professional whilst having the option to close our camera off for those unexpected interruptions!
